Clik turns your Smartphone into a remote control

 
By: Amy on Apps, Feb 17, 2012
 
 
The entry of Apps has allowed our cellphones to be used as instruments for calculating, writing, texting, surfing, etc, etc, etc. Now, there's an App launched yesterday called Clik, based in Canada, that claims to turn your Smartphone into a remote control for Browser-based screens, i.e. all screens which are connected to the Web. 
 
HERE'S HOW WORKS:
 
Step 1: Download the App from the iTunes Store or Android Market onto your phone & follow the instructions on how to connect your phone screen to any screen with a Browser.

Step 2: Go to www.clikthis.com on your Browser screen & use your Smartphone to scan the QR code you see there. This will synch the phone & the screen using the Smartphone's cellular or WiFi connection). It's done.
 
How can you use this App? Lets say you are hanging out with a bunch of friends. You want to show off some videos. Rather than gather around your tiny Smartphone screen, you simply scan your iPhone or Android across the TV and show it off on the larger screen. You may even use Clik in the multi-player mode.
This App is Free.
